A Chelsea player has admitted that they only have themselves to blame after failing to beat Qarabag last night.

Chelsea were 1-0 up in the game after a lovely finish from Estevao Willian, but they then ended up giving away two cheap goals to allow Qarabag to take the lead. They were then saved by an Alejandro Garnacho goal after he came on as a sub at half time.

Chelsea were very bad in the first half but got better in the second half. Qarabag were very impressive and didn’t deserve to be the losing side at all and a draw was a justified and deserved result for them.

But Blues fans would have been embarrassed by some of the defending that they once again saw from their side, handing two goals to the opponents really.

And a draw against Qarabag, whether they played well or not, is just simply not good enough for a club like Chelsea.

Captain Reece James has been left disappointed by the performance of his team.

‘Yes it’s disappointing,’ a frustrated James said when speaking post-match in the media zone. ‘Coming here we wanted to win, of course.

‘We set up pretty strong and we started well, got ourselves in front and then it’s disappointing to let it slip. The goals we conceded weren’t good from our perspective. We gave away a penalty and a goal that we really gifted them.

‘It’s disappointing. We didn’t adapt well enough to certain situations and the goals we’ve conceded, it’s from our own sloppy play. That’s something, collectively, we need to improve on going forward.

‘The momentum changed with their goal and simply, we didn’t do enough. We had chances towards the end to win the game, but we didn’t take them and we only have ourselves to blame in not taking all three points.’

Amazing Estevao

‘Estevao is an amazing player and he has the world at his feet,’ James said of our first goalscorer.

‘He’s still so young and it’s on us to keep him grounded, protect him and make sure he stays healthy. He’s got a lot of development sill to come but we’re super happy with his performances and to have him here with us.’
